← 返回部落格

SillyTavern 角色卡故障排除:修復常見錯誤,提升 2026 年 AI 回覆品質

在使用 SillyTavern 進行角色扮演時,一張精心製作的角色卡是獲得沉浸式 AI 回覆的關鍵。然而,許多用戶在實際操作中會遇到各種問題:角色突然「失憶」、回覆偏離設定、甚至卡片完全無法載入。本文將為你提供一份針對 2026 年最新版本的 SillyTavern 角色卡故障排除指南,幫助你快速修復常見錯誤,並顯著提升 AI 回覆的連貫性與深度。

發布於
  • troubleshooting
  • character-cards
  • errors
  • ai-responses
  • sillytavern

SillyTavern 角色卡故障排除:修復常見錯誤,提升 2026 年 AI 回覆品質

在使用 SillyTavern 進行角色扮演時,一張精心製作的角色卡(Character Card)是獲得沉浸式 AI 回覆的關鍵。然而,許多用戶在實際操作中會遇到各種問題:角色突然「失憶」、回覆偏離設定、甚至卡片完全無法載入。本文將為你提供一份針對 2026 年最新版本的 SillyTavern 角色卡故障排除指南,幫助你快速修復常見錯誤,並顯著提升 AI 回覆的連貫性與深度。

為了更直觀地說明問題,我們將以一張名為「Seraphina the Stubborn Sorceress」的精選角色卡為例,逐步剖析從載入到對話優化的全過程。

角色卡載入錯誤:檔案格式與路徑問題

無法載入 PNG 或 JSON 檔案

SillyTavern 支援 PNG 和 JSON 兩種格式的角色卡。如果你在匯入「Seraphina the Stubborn Sorceress」時遇到「檔案損毀」或「格式不支援」的提示,請按以下步驟排查:

  1. 檢查副檔名:確保檔案副檔名為 .png.json。有時下載的檔案會被瀏覽器自動重新命名(如 .png.txt),手動修正即可。
  2. 驗證 PNG 隱藏資料:SillyTavern 的 PNG 角色卡會將角色資料嵌入圖片的元資料中。使用線上 PNG 元資料檢視器(如 exif.regex.info)檢查圖片是否包含 characharacter 欄位。如果沒有,說明該 PNG 並非標準 SillyTavern 卡片。
  3. JSON 結構校驗:使用 JSON 格式化工具(如 jsonlint.com)檢查 JSON 檔案。確保包含 namedescriptionpersonality 等關鍵欄位。Seraphina 的卡片中必須包含 "name": "Seraphina the Stubborn Sorceress" 欄位,否則 SillyTavern 會拒絕載入。

卡片匯入後角色資訊遺失

如果 Seraphina 的卡片成功匯入,但對話中她完全不記得自己的「固執女巫」身份,問題可能出在 角色定義(Character Definition) 的格式上。2026 年的 SillyTavern 對卡片中的 system_promptpost_history_instructions 欄位有嚴格的位置要求。請確保:

  • 在 JSON 的 data 物件中,system_prompt 位於 alternate_greetings 之前。
  • 使用 {{char}}{{user}} 佔位符來明確角色與用戶身份。例如:{{char}} 是 Seraphina the Stubborn Sorceress,她絕不會輕易改變主意。

角色回覆偏離設定:優化 AI 響應品質

角色性格表現不一致

即使 Seraphina 的卡片載入成功,你可能會發現她有時表現得溫順,有時又過於暴躁——這完全違背了「固執」(Stubborn)這一核心特質。這種問題通常源於角色提示詞(Character Prompt)系統提示詞(System Prompt) 的衝突。

解決方案

  1. 強化核心特質:在角色卡中的 personality 欄位內,使用明確的行為指令。例如:Seraphina 在討論魔法理論時絕不讓步,即使證據相反也要堅持自己的觀點。 而不是籠統的「她很固執」。
  2. 調整溫度參數:在 SillyTavern 的 AI 響應設定中,將溫度(Temperature) 調低至 0.6-0.8。過高的溫度(>1.0)會導致 AI 過度隨機,忽視角色設定。
  3. 使用角色卡市場驗證:如果你是從 MiniTavern 角色卡市場下載 Seraphina 的卡片,可以查看其他用戶的評價——「AI 回覆是否忠於原設」是篩選高品質卡片的重要指標。

對話歷史過長導致角色「失憶」

當與 Seraphina 進行了 100 輪對話後,她可能會忘記自己曾拒絕過某個魔法交易。這是因為 SillyTavern 的上下文視窗(Context Window)有限,舊資訊會被擠出。

進階修復技巧

  • 啟用「角色卡摘要」功能:在 SillyTavern 的擴充設定中,打開「Character Card Summarization」。系統會自動為 Seraphina 的長期記憶產生摘要,並注入到每次對話的提示詞中。
  • 手動固化關鍵資訊:在角色卡 post_history_instructions 欄位中,寫入永久性提示,如:永遠記住:Seraphina 在童年時期被火龍詛咒過,因此她對任何龍族生物都充滿敵意。 這比依賴對話歷史更可靠。

常見錯誤代碼與快速修復

「Invalid character card data」錯誤

這是 2026 年 SillyTavern 更新後最常見的錯誤。通常由以下原因引起:

  • 欄位名稱大小寫錯誤:SillyTavern 要求欄位名嚴格遵循駝峰命名法(camelCase)。例如 alternate_greetings 不能寫成 alternate_greetingsAlternateGreetings。Seraphina 的卡片中,first_mes(首次訊息)欄位必須小寫。
  • 缺少必要欄位:2026 年版本新增了 spec_version 欄位。如果卡片沒有此欄位,SillyTavern 會拒絕載入。你可以在 JSON 頂部添加 "spec_version": "2.0" 來解決。
  • 巢狀資料層級錯誤:角色資料必須位於 data 物件下,而不是直接位於 JSON 根目錄。例如:
    {
      "data": {
        "name": "Seraphina the Stubborn Sorceress",
        ...
      }
    }

圖片預覽不顯示

如果 Seraphina 的 PNG 卡片匯入後,角色頭像區域顯示為空白,原因可能是:

  • 圖片尺寸不符合要求:SillyTavern 對角色卡圖片的推薦尺寸為 512x512 像素。過大或過小的圖片可能導致渲染失敗。使用圖片編輯工具將 Seraphina 的圖片調整為正方形即可。
  • 圖片顏色模式問題:某些 PNG 檔案使用了 CMYK 顏色模式(常見於設計軟體匯出),而 SillyTavern 僅支援 RGB 模式。使用線上轉換工具將圖片轉為 RGB 模式。

提升 AI 回覆的深度與創意

利用角色卡中的「範例對話」欄位

Seraphina 的卡片如果包含高品質的範例對話(Example Messages),AI 回覆的品質會有飛躍性的提升。範例對話應展示角色在特定情境下的典型反應。例如:

<START>
{{user}}: 女巫,你的魔法書看起來破舊不堪。
{{char}}: Seraphina 冷笑一聲,手指輕輕拂過書脊:「這本書記錄了三次屠龍戰役的咒語,而你連驅蚊咒都念不全。」
<END>

這樣的範例不僅定義了角色語氣,還暗示了背景故事。2026 年的 SillyTavern 支援最多 10 組範例對話,建議針對不同情緒(憤怒、嘲諷、悲傷)各準備 2-3 組。

與 MiniTavern 生態聯動優化

當你對 Seraphina 的卡片進行本地除錯時,可以從 MiniTavern 角色卡市場 下載社群優化版。這些卡片通常經過了多次迭代,修復了常見錯誤,並嵌入了更智能的提示詞。此外,使用 MiniTavern 的 Chrome 擴充功能,你可以直接在瀏覽網頁時一鍵儲存角色設定,避免手動複製貼上導致的格式錯誤。

結論:從故障排除到沉浸式體驗

解決 SillyTavern 角色卡錯誤並不複雜——關鍵在於理解檔案格式、欄位規範以及 AI 響應參數之間的相互作用。透過本文的指導,你應該能夠輕鬆修復 Seraphina the Stubborn Sorceress 卡片載入失敗、性格偏移或「失憶」等問題。

但故障排除只是第一步。想要真正享受與 Seraphina 的魔法對決,你需要一個更完整的工具鏈。MiniTavern 生態系統 提供了無縫的跨平台體驗:你可以在 iOS/Android 應用上隨時隨地與角色互動,在 Web 端進行深度編輯,並透過 Chrome 擴充功能快速抓取網路上的角色靈感。而 MiniTavern 角色卡市場 則是發現高品質卡片(如 Seraphina 的 2.0 優化版)的最佳途徑。

現在,打開你的 SillyTavern,匯入 Seraphina 的卡片,開始一段不會偏離軌道的魔法冒險吧。如果遇到任何新問題,記得回到 MiniTavern 社群尋求幫助——那裡有成千上萬和你一樣的角色卡愛好者。

你可能還會喜歡這些文章

如何打造一份完美的 SillyTavern 角色卡模板:2026 年最佳實踐指南

在 SillyTavern 生態中,一張高品質的角色卡是沉浸式角色扮演體驗的核心。無論是你精心設計的原創角色,還是從社群獲取的靈感,掌握角色卡模板的製作方法,都能讓你的互動更加生動、可控。本文將圍繞 2026 年的最新實踐,以「魅惑女巫艾琳娜」(Elena the Enchantress)為範例,帶你一步步構…

  • sillytavern
  • character-card
  • template
  • guide
閱讀全文

SillyTavern 角色卡故障排除指南:修復常見錯誤並優化 AI 回應

在 SillyTavern 的世界裡,角色卡是塑造沉浸式對話體驗的核心。無論是使用 MiniTavern 的 iOS/Android 應用在行動端與角色互動,還是在 Web Tavern 中除錯複雜場景,一張精心設計的角色卡都能讓 AI 回應變得生動自然。然而,即使是經驗豐富的玩家,也難免遇到角色卡載入失敗、…

  • troubleshooting
  • errors
  • fix
  • ai-responses
閱讀全文

SillyTavern 角色卡新手教學:2026 年如何建立你的第一張角色卡

在 AI 角色扮演的世界裡,一張精心設計的角色卡就像為虛擬角色注入了靈魂。無論你是想與心儀的動漫角色對話,還是創造屬於自己的奇幻世界,SillyTavern 的角色卡系統都能幫你實現。2026 年,隨著 AI 技術的飛速發展,角色卡的創作門檻已經大幅降低,即使是零基礎的新手,也能在 15 分鐘內打造出令人驚豔的互動角色。…

  • sillytavern
  • character-cards
  • tutorial
  • beginners
閱讀全文